A 35 m² studio with a mezzanine for 2 people on Chmielna Street on Granary Island in Gdańsk. Pink accents, a large pull-out sofa, a reading and work nook on the mezzanine, and a private terrace with a small garden on the ground floor. It’s a 9-minute walk from here to Długi Targ.
POP ART treats color exactly as its name suggests: with a touch of whimsy. Pink chairs surround a round table, pink pillows rest on a gray corduroy sofa, and a “WOW!” poster hangs in the bathroom. A mezzanine runs above the living area—wooden stairs with a steel railing lead up to a nook with a small green sofa and an LED strip under the ceiling. Here, you can read, set up your laptop, and have a home office with a view of the entire studio.
You’ll sleep on a large corner sofa bed—comfortable for two people. The apartment is located on the ground floor, and the living room opens onto a private terrace with a wooden deck, a small table, and a garden. The black built-in kitchenette is equipped with an induction cooktop, microwave, dishwasher, refrigerator, and coffee maker; the bathroom features a shower stall and a washing machine. The building has an elevator. A parking space in the garage is available at no additional charge—advance reservation required.
Chmielna 72 is located in the central part of Granary Island, on the quiet side of the street. It’s a 9-minute walk to Długi Targ and the Neptune Fountain—via Chmielna Street, past the Błękitny Baranek granary and the Archaeological Museum, and then across the Krowi Bridge to Ogarną Street. The restaurants on Stągiewna Street and the Motława River waterfront are also within a short walk.
POP ART is perfect for couples on a city break and for people visiting Gdańsk for a longer stay with a laptop—the mezzanine separates work from relaxation better than many a desk tucked away in the corner of a living room. And if there are more than two of you, you can rent POP ART together with the adjacent CINEMA —accommodating up to six people in total.
